Output 3ed361119e1cfccf5633fc48a77bbfd01bb9296221fc2d2fc8b99d8d3810c7a4:4

value
6487044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95650a9241c3214d5452fe18d51542329a28893 OP_EQUAL
address
3H8PXEso6iVEr8C78iKuxFyr5zkpYZHDyo
transaction
3ed361119e1cfccf5633fc48a77bbfd01bb9296221fc2d2fc8b99d8d3810c7a4
spent
true